General Characteristics of Marsupials

  • Focus on marsupials as a diverse taxonomic group, including global distribution and distinguishing anatomical traits.

  • Unique reproductive system involving shorter gestation and longer lactation periods.

Anatomy of Marsupials

  • Distinct traits include:

    • Lower body temperature than eutherians.

    • Unique reproductive structure: two uteri and three vaginae.

    • Hallux (opposable first digit on hind feet).

  • Differences in skull and musculature:

    • Narrow oral gape and reduced brain size compared to eutherians.

    • Fenestrated hard palate.

Pouch Dynamics and Function

  • Structure and function of the pouch crucial for the survival of underdeveloped neonates.

  • Lactation process with varying milk composition according to developmental stages.

  • Cleaning and maintaining pouch hygiene is essential for young survival.

Marsupial Male Anatomy Differentiations

  • Males have internal testes; penis located in a pocket behind scrotum.

  • Possible intersex anatomical variations due to chromosomal differences.

Physiological Aspects

  • Lower metabolic rate and body temperature in marsupials; effective in various environments.

  • Adaptations for nutrient maintenance and increased metabolism in cold conditions.
